Regarding xbox version, according to this site, if there's no continuity between pin 2 and ground, then it's a 1.5. I recently checked a board with the Focus video chip and it had continuity between the 2 points, making it a 1.4.

What do VGA-patched BIOSes do when a VGA adapter is detected? Force 480p mode even when a game selects 480i? i seem to remember something about VGA not working right with Xcalibur (v1.6) systems - is that true?
It fixes a green screen problem some games have. When VGA is used the console doesn't detect that. It is still in component mode and some games with have green tint on the screen. As for not working on 1.6, I have no idea as I don't like messing with 1.6 consoles.
